Significant differences between Escarole and Leek

  • Escarole has more Vitamin K, Vitamin B5, and Zinc, however, Leek is richer in Iron, Vitamin B6, and Vitamin C.
  • Escarole covers your daily Vitamin K needs 137% more than Leek.
  • Leek has 6 times less Vitamin B5 than Escarole. Escarole has 0.826mg of Vitamin B5, while Leek has 0.14mg.

Specific food types used in this comparison are Escarole, cooked, boiled, drained, no salt added and Leeks, (bulb and lower leaf-portion), raw.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Escarole Leek Opinion
Calories 19kcal 61kcal Leek
Protein 1.15g 1.5g Leek
Fats 0.18g 0.3g Leek
Vitamin C 3.3mg 12mg Leek
Net carbs 0.27g 12.35g Leek
Carbs 3.07g 14.15g Leek
Magnesium 13mg 28mg Leek
Calcium 46mg 59mg Leek
Potassium 245mg 180mg Escarole
Iron 0.72mg 2.1mg Leek
Sugar 0.23g 3.9g Escarole
Fiber 2.8g 1.8g Escarole
Copper 0.087mg 0.12mg Leek
Zinc 0.69mg 0.12mg Escarole
Phosphorus 22mg 35mg Leek
Sodium 19mg 20mg Escarole
Vitamin A 1888IU 1667IU Escarole
Vitamin A RAE 94µg 83µg Escarole
Vitamin E 0.4mg 0.92mg Leek
Manganese 0.385mg 0.481mg Leek
Selenium 0.2µg 1µg Leek
Vitamin B1 0.059mg 0.06mg Leek
Vitamin B2 0.062mg 0.03mg Escarole
Vitamin B3 0.312mg 0.4mg Leek
Vitamin B5 0.826mg 0.14mg Escarole
Vitamin B6 0.016mg 0.233mg Leek
Vitamin K 211.9µg 47µg Escarole
Folate 78µg 64µg Escarole
Choline 15.4mg 9.5mg Escarole
Saturated Fat 0.042g 0.04g Leek
Monounsaturated Fat 0.004g 0.004g
Polyunsaturated fat 0.081g 0.166g Leek
